Check NowNEW DELHI: All India Institute of Medical Sciences (AIIMS), New Delhi has started the open round counselling of AIIMS PG 2020 for admission to remaining vacant seats. Along with it, AIIMS MD/MS/MDS open round information brochure has been released. As per the brochure, the online registration for open round counselling can be done till August 10, 2020, 5:00 PM. Candidates who fulfill the required eligibility criteria can participate for online counselling. The vacant seats left for AIIMS PG open round allotment will be released on aiimsexams.org.

Who is eligible for AIIMS PG 2020 open round counselling?
Candidates who have secured minimum cutoff 50th percentile and corresponding scores will be considered eligible to participate for open round counselling. Also, all the aspirants who wish to appear for open round seat allotment need to submit their original certificate and Rs. 3 lakh through Demand Draft (DD) or RTGS/NEFT on or before the last date.
After AIIMS PG counselling registration 2020
Medical/dental graduates must take a printout of confirmation page after complete registration. Thereafter, they will be allowed to provide their preferences of colleges as well as courses, in which they wish to take admission. Based on the choices filled, AIIMS PG rank, seats availability, reservation criteria and other factors, the admission to eight AIIMS institutes will be granted.
After the announcement of AIIMS PG 2020 counselling result, shortlisted candidates have to provide whether they wish to accept/withdraw the allotted seat. If they accept the seat, they need to report at the allotted college for completion of admission formalities and joining the seat.
